Jump to content
ElementaryOS France
  • 0
WesK

L'update de Windows 10 d'hier m'a flingué mon Grub !

Question

Bonjour à toutes et à tous !

 

Y'a deux jours, une grosse mise à jour de Windows 10 est venue flingué mon Grub. Depuis il m'est donc impossible de booter sur mon eOS 😢

J'ai testé plusieurs choses avant de venir demander de l'aide ici.

  1. J'ai en effet tenté un boot-repair via l'iso booté sur USb mais ça ne fonctionne pas.
  2. Ensuite, j'ai tenté un os-prober mais il ne m'affiche que mon Windows. Tenté un grub-install sans succès.
  3. Installé l'iso de Rescatux pour utiliser le rescapp mais ça ne me donne que des erreurs.

Sur Gparted, j'ai bien ma partition /dev/sda en flag lba qui comprend mon swap et mon ext4 avec mon OS.

Je pense que mon grub a sauté mais je n'arrive pas à le reconfigurer.

Mon boot info ici : paste.debian.net/1135115

Share this post


Link to post
Share on other sites

10 answers to this question

Recommended Posts

  • 0

Bonjour @WesK,

peut-être que l'entrée elementary a été rendue inactive, essaie efibootmgr pour vérifier si ça répond à ton problème:

https://doc.ubuntu-fr.org/efibootmgr

Share this post


Link to post
Share on other sites
  • 0

Bonjour @lafy,

Merci pour ton message mais je possède une carte mère pas toute récente et doncsans UEFI. J'ai un Bios classique.

Du coup si je tente un efibootmgr -v j'ai ce retour :

EFI variables are not supported on this system

 

Share this post


Link to post
Share on other sites
  • 0

Il est particulier ton plan de partitionnement...

Pour synthétiser, tu as deux SSD, pour le premier le schéma est le suivant :
 

sda1: __________________________________________________________________________

    File system:       ntfs
    Boot sector type:  Windows 8/2012: NTFS
    Boot sector info:  No errors found in the Boot Parameter Block.
    Operating System:  
    Boot files:        /bootmgr /Boot/BCD /Windows/System32/winload.exe

sda2: __________________________________________________________________________

    File system:       ntfs
    Boot sector type:  Windows 8/2012: NTFS
    Boot sector info:  No errors found in the Boot Parameter Block.
    Operating System:  
    Boot files:        

sda3: __________________________________________________________________________

    File system:       Extended Partition
    Boot sector type:  -
    Boot sector info:

sda5: __________________________________________________________________________

    File system:       swap
    Boot sector type:  -
    Boot sector info:

sda6: __________________________________________________________________________

    File system:       ext4
    Boot sector type:  -
    Boot sector info:
    Operating System:  
    Boot files: 

Pour le deuxième :

sdb1: __________________________________________________________________________

    File system:       
    Boot sector type:  -
    Boot sector info: 

sdb2: __________________________________________________________________________

    File system:       ntfs
    Boot sector type:  Windows 8/2012: NTFS
    Boot sector info:  No errors found in the Boot Parameter Block.
    Operating System:  
    Boot files:        

Ouaip....

Je fonctionne aussi en dual boot pour l'instant, et, Windows refusant de s'installer ou de démarrer sur un disque non principal, j'ai dû faire l'installation sur mon premier disque de Windows et sur mon deuxième disque Elementary OS. Dans le Bios, je lui ai demandé de booter sur le deuxième disque.

Nikos

Share this post


Link to post
Share on other sites
  • 0

Bonjour @Nikos et merci de te joindre à la conversation pour tenter de m'aider.

Malheureusement, ça n'avance pas.Ca parle tout le temps d'UEFI mais moi je ne peux pas switcher en UEFI.

Je tente d'autres techniques pour venir à bout de mon problème. je ne manquerai pas d'expliquer la démarche si j'avais j'arrive à fixer mon problème.

Je partage avec vous un screen du boot repair (options avancées) qui ne me permet pas d'avoir les options ou emplacement liées au grub mais seulement au mbr alors que je suis sur le live usb d'elementaryOs. C'est étrange, le grub a carrément sauté. faut que je le réinstalle. Je me souviens qu'une fois j'avais dû set le root de mon linux en passant par le grub rescue mais là je n'y ai pas accès. Peut-être est-ce la solution.   

Capture-d’écran-de-2020-03-17-08-23-14-min-compressor.png

Share this post


Link to post
Share on other sites
  • 0

Alors, j'essaie de suivre ce How to (https://askubuntu.com/questions/88384/how-can-i-repair-grub-how-to-get-ubuntu-back-after-installing-windows) pour réinstaller le grub.

Mais je bloque sur un aspect des commandes.

Je sais que mon eOS est sur sda6.

Du coup, je fais ça. Je monte la partition :

sudo mount /dev/sda6 /mnt

Ensuite au moment de monter les autres éléments nécessaires en faisant :

for i in /sys /proc /run /dev; do sudo mount --bind "$i" "/mnt$i"; done

Mais j'ai une erreur :

mount: /mnt/sys : le point de montage n'existe pas.
mount: /mnt/proc : le point de montage n'existe pas.
mount: /mnt/run : le point de montage n'existe pas.
mount: /mnt/dev : le point de montage n'existe pas.

En effet, mes dossiers sys, proc, run, dev sont à la racine pas dans mon dossier mnt. Du coup, ma question est la suivante. Dois-je plutôt lancer cette commande avant de passer en chroot pour faire l'upgrade puis l'install de grub ?

for i in /sys /proc /run /dev; do sudo mount --bind "$i" "/$i"; done

 

Share this post


Link to post
Share on other sites
  • 0

Bonjour à tous et toutes.

Je reviens vers vous pour de l'aide 😢
Je n'arrive pas à réparer mon eOS suite à cette *ù*^$) d'update de Windaube.

J'ai tout essayé, j'ai suivi plein de tuto mais je n'y arrive pas. Hier encore, j'y ai passé 7h 😢

Je n'arrive pas à récupérer mon grub. Il n'est plus présent sur ma partition linux.. les fichiers ne sont plus là (ou pas au bon endroit ?). J'avais réussi l'autre fois quand j'ai eu ce souci en passant par l'invite de grub afin de set correctement le boot. Mais là, je n'y arrive pas.

Est-ce qu'il y a moyen de cp les fichiers nécessaires au boot depuis le live CD d'eOS en espérant que ça fixe mon souci ? Si oui, quels fichiers et où les placer ?

Bien cordialement.

 

Share this post


Link to post
Share on other sites
  • 0

Bonjour @Wesk,

on aimerait bien t'aider, je ne sais pas, je ne comprends pas le dernier tuto que tu as suivi. Je déteste grub-rescue, il met des fichiers partout. Les commandes que j'utilise habituellement ne semblent pas fonctionner pour toi.

1- Est-ce qu'il n'y a rien de bloqué en amont au niveau du bios ?

Le 16/03/2020 à 11:54, WesK a dit :

Ensuite, j'ai tenté un os-prober mais il ne m'affiche que mon Windows. Tenté un grub-install sans succès.

2- qu'est-ce qui ne fonctionne pas avec  grub-install  ?

3- Au pire si tu n'en sors pas, il existe refind qui est une alternative à grub, il y a moyen de l'enlever ensuite quand tu auras rétabli la situation https://doc.ubuntu-fr.org/refind mais mais encore une fois je ne suis pas sure que ça marche sur ton ordinateur.

Bon courage

Share this post


Link to post
Share on other sites
  • 0
Le 17/03/2020 à 10:07, WesK a dit :

En effet, mes dossiers sys, proc, run, dev sont à la racine pas dans mon dossier mnt

pour le tuto, je crois que /mnt est juste un nom que tu donnes à ton point de montage, donc bien à la racine de ton /sda6, tu peux l'appeler comme tu veux, par contre c'est bizarre qu'il ne trouve pas tes répertoires à cet endroit. Vérifie avec sudo fdisk -l que ta partition n'est pas vide ou essaie de vérifier que les dossiers sont bien toujours là depuis une clé d'install.

 

Share this post


Link to post
Share on other sites
  • 0
Il y a 19 heures, lafy a dit :

pour le tuto, je crois que /mnt est juste un nom que tu donnes à ton point de montage, donc bien à la racine de ton /sda6, tu peux l'appeler comme tu veux, par contre c'est bizarre qu'il ne trouve pas tes répertoires à cet endroit. Vérifie avec sudo fdisk -l que ta partition n'est pas vide ou essaie de vérifier que les dossiers sont bien toujours là depuis une clé d'install.

 

Bonjour @lafy

Oui, c'est bien ça pour le /mnt. C'est un dossier temporaire qui permet de monter ma partition linux et donc y avoir accès depuis un Live CD/USB afin de le réparer. Bref, j'en ai eu marre alors j'ai tout reformaté et réinstallé eOS ! Il me reste plus qu'à remettre mes apps, mes customisations (genre thème, effet zoom sur le plank (je crois qu'il ne marche plus d'ailleurs sur la 5.1 si je dis pas de bêtises ?), etc).

J'ai installé Timeshift histoire de pouvoir avoir des points de restoration. Par contre, y'a-t-il un moyen de faire en sorte que le boot ne ressaute pas après une màj Windows ? Un /boot séparé ? Je sais pas.

En tout cas merci pour l'aide que tu as bien voulu me donner.

 

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...